A small crew on an isolated oil refinery in the middle of the Arctic nowhere watches the world end from a mysterious disease on their televisions. The world stops broadcasting. The resupply ship never makes it, and supplies won't last the arctic winter. That's the least of these people's problems.

This is one of the best zombie novels I've read since World War Z. The author definitely seems to have "found his voice" and his writing style is a pleasure to read - it's not bombastic or convoluted; I'm sure many readers would call it a page-turner. There is maybe a *touch* too much nerd revenge if there can be too much of such a thing.
